A Network Interface Module (NIM) is a hardware device used to connect a computer to a network. It provides an interface between the network and the computer, allowing data to be transmitted and received. NIMs are typically used in routers, switches, and other networking equipment. They are also used in industrial automation systems, such as those used in factories and warehouses. NIMs are designed to be reliable and secure, and they are often used in mission-critical applications. They are available in a variety of form factors, including PCI, PCIe, and USB.
